With this combination of attachments, you could have either the S380-33 or S385-33 channel balance. You’ll need to measure as shown below. The Series 380 has a 1" bottom attachment, and the Series 385 has a 1-3/32" attachment. You'll also need 3240 spring strength options for your replacement balances.

Hi - Don't the channel balance and the sash guide match? So I installed the channel balance provided in pics, and wondering if there is a sash guide that matches it? Or is each sash guide made for a specific window?

Unforutnately, your balances are not designed to work with one specific top sash guide. It really just depends on the combination the window manufacturer decides will work best for the window's specifications. This is why we recommend replacements for these parts based on the configuration and dimensions of the original hardware.
